These bolts are characterized by their hexagonal sockets, which allow them to be driven with a hex key or Allen wrench. This design not only provides a sleek finish but also ensures that the bolt head does not protrude, contributing to the aesthetics and functionality of the assembly. Fine threading further enhances their usability, ensuring a stronger grip and allowing for finer adjustments when securing or aligning components. This precision makes them particularly useful in industries like aerospace and automotive, where exact fit and alignment are crucial. One of the standout features of fine thread hexagon socket bolts is their load-bearing capacity. Fine threads have more threads per inch compared to coarse threads, which means they can handle more stress without stripping. This attribute is particularly valuable in high-stress environments, such as heavy machinery or structural applications, where failure is not an option. Moreover, the increased surface area of fine threads offers improved resistance to loosening due to vibration, a common issue in dynamic systems.

In terms of installation, fine thread hexagon socket bolts offer a user-friendly experience. The hexagonal socket allows for easy access even in tight spaces where a traditional screw head might obstruct. This ease of use is complemented by the increased torque provided by the hex design, ensuring a secure fit without damaging the material being fastened. The precise alignment facilitated by the fine threads also aids in achieving a perfect fit, crucial in assemblies requiring airtight or fluid connections.
